The word "runner" refers to a person who runs, especially in sports or for pleasure. It can also describe a horse in a race, someone involved in illegal transport (like drugs or guns), a messenger, or someone employed for small tasks. Additionally, it can refer to a part of a mechanism that allows smooth movement, a plant's spreading stem, or a long, narrow rug.

Collins
runner ★★★☆☆
/rʌ̱nə(r)/
1
[N-COUNT 可数名词]跑步者;赛跑者 A runner is a person who runs, especially for sport or pleasure.
  • ...a marathon runner...

    马拉松长跑选手

  • I am a very keen runner and am out training most days.

    我非常喜欢跑步,大多数时候都在户外训练。

2
[N-COUNT 可数名词]参加赛马的马匹;赛马 The runners in a horse race are the horses taking part.
  • There are 18 runners in the top race of the day.

    在当天最高级别的赛马中有18匹马参加。

3
[N-COUNT 可数名词]走私者;偷运者 A drug runner or gun runner is someone who illegally takes drugs or guns into a country.
  [n N]
    4
    [N-COUNT 可数名词]送信人;信使;收账员;听差 Someone who is a runner for a particular person or company is employed to take messages, collect money, or do other small tasks for them.
    • ...a bookie's runner.

      赌注经纪人的听差

    5
    [N-COUNT 可数名词](雪橇的)滑板;(冰鞋的)冰刀;(抽屉的)滑轨 Runners are thin strips of wood or metal underneath something which help it to move smoothly.
      [usu pl]
    • ...the runners of his sled.

      他的雪橇的滑板

    6
    [N-COUNT 可数名词](植物的)长匐茎,纤匐枝 On a plant, runners are long shoots that grow from the main stem and put down roots to form a new plant.
      [usu pl]
    • ...strawberry runners.

      草莓长匐茎

    7
    [N-COUNT 可数名词]长条地毯;长条饰布 A runner is a long narrow mat that is put on a piece of furniture or on the floor.
      8
      [PHRASE 短语]匆匆离开;迅速逃离;溜掉 If someone does a runner, they leave a place in a hurry, for example in order to escape arrest or to avoid paying for something.
        [V inflects]
        [BRIT 英]
        [INFORMAL 非正式]
      • At this point, the accountant did a runner — with all my bank statements, expenses and receipts.

        这个时候,会计溜了——带走了我所有的银行结算单、资金和收据。
